Устройство для ввода информации Советский патент 1982 года по МПК G06F3/02 

Описание патента на изобретение SU959058A1

(54) УСТРОЙСТВО ДЛЯ ВВОДА ИНФОРМАЦИИ

Похожие патенты SU959058A1

название год авторы номер документа
Устройство для ввода информации 1983
  • Журавлев Марк Иванович
SU1092486A1
Устройство для контроля знаний обучаемых 1990
  • Айзенцон Александр Ефимович
  • Кудинов Владимир Иванович
SU1758658A1
Устройство для ввода информации 1989
  • Русаков Владимир Дмитриевич
SU1682996A1
Устройство для ввода информации 1982
  • Ильина Раиса Сергеевна
  • Карасенко Николай Петрович
  • Прядкин Виктор Максимович
  • Разумный Владимир Тихонович
  • Сивцов Анатолий Константинович
SU1089566A1
Логический анализатор 1986
  • Цуркан Николай Андреевич
  • Клименко Сергей Иванович
  • Высоцкий Владимир Васильевич
  • Довгань Виктор Евгеньевич
  • Беликов Борис Петрович
SU1432527A1
Устройство для управления пишущей машинкой 1981
  • Силаков Владимир Григорьевич
  • Никончук Валерий Иванович
  • Шуткевич Николай Иванович
  • Березов Анатолий Семенович
SU951289A2
Позиционный дискретный электропривод 1985
  • Кацалап Сергей Михайлович
  • Афонин Анатолий Алексеевич
  • Бондаренко Валерий Иванович
  • Федоров Юрий Николаевич
SU1352474A1
Устройство для ввода и вывода информации 1982
  • Журавлев Марк Иванович
SU1048466A1
Многоканальная система для контроля и диагностики цифровых блоков 1984
  • Гроза Петр Кирилович
  • Касиян Иван Леонович
  • Кошулян Иван Михайлович
  • Карабаджак Александр Александрович
  • Гобжила Алик Степанович
  • Иваненко Владислав Николаевич
  • Баранов Валерий Степанович
  • Кац Ефим Файвельевич
SU1269137A1
Устройство автоматизированной подготовки программ для станков с ЧПУ 1986
  • Кулабухов Анатолий Михайлович
  • Ларин Владимир Алексеевич
  • Чесноков Юрий Александрович
  • Якушкин Михаил Александрович
  • Анисимов Николай Николаевич
  • Луковников Аркадий Алексеевич
  • Сидоров Евгений Михайлович
SU1354160A1

Иллюстрации к изобретению SU 959 058 A1

Реферат патента 1982 года Устройство для ввода информации

Формула изобретения SU 959 058 A1

Изобретение относится к автоматике и вычислительной технике и может быть использовано в качестве п-канального пульта различных систем и устройств ввода информации для набора If передачи массивов информации произвольной длины при ограниченном числе линий связи между пультом и приемным устройством.

Известно устройство для ввода информации, которое содержит блок переключателей, шифратор, блок памяти и блок управления 1.

Недостатком этого устройства является его сложность.

Наиболее близким по технической сущности к изобретению является устройство для ввода информации, содержащее клавиатуру, подключенную через шифратор к первому входу блока памяти, одновибратор, подключенный к второму входу блока памяти, элемент ИЛИ/ подключенный к третьему входу блока пгиляти и генератор, подключенный k входу распределителя импул| сов 2.

Не; остатками известного устройства являются сложность обработки инфор мации вследствие ее непрерывного поступления на выход и отсутствия привязки к началу ввода, фиксированная

длина вводимой информации, отсутствие контрольного разряда и возможности передачи информсщи 1 по длинным линиям связи.

Цель изобретения - расширение области применения устройства путем ввода массива данных произвольной длины.

Поставленная цель достигается тем,

10 что в устройство для ввода информации, содержащее клавиатуру, первый выход которой подключен через шифратор к первому входу блока памяти, первый одновибратор, подключенный к

15 второму входу блока Пс1мяти, первый элемент ИЛИ, подключенный к третьему входу блока памяти, и генератор, подключенный к входу распределителя ; импульсов, введены формирователь кон

20 трольного разряда, первый и второй элементы ИЛИ, триггер, второй одновибратор, счетчик адреса и блок усилителей, причем вход формирователя контрольного разряда соединен с вы25ходом шифратора и первым входом второго элемента ИЛИ, а выход - с четвертым входом блока памяти, пятый вход которого соединен с вторым выходом клавиатуры, первым входом триг30гера и вторым входом второго элемента ИЛИ, третий вход которого соединен с третьим выходом клавиатуры и первым входом счетчика адреса, а выход второго элемента ИЛИ подключен к входу первого одновибратора, выход которого соединен с первыми входами первого и третьего элемента ИЛИ и вторым входом триггера, третий вход KOTOfJoro соединен с вторым выходом блока памяти, а выход триггера - с входами генератора и второго одновиб раторз, выход которого соединен с вторым входом .счетчика адреса, выход которого подключен к шестому вхо ду блока памяти, а третий вход счетчика адреса соединен с выходом треть его элемента ИЛИ, второй вход которого соединен с первым выходом распределителя импульсов, второй выход которого является управляющим выходом устройства и подключен к второму входу первого элемента ИЛИ и к первому входу блока усилителей, второй вход которого соединен с первым выходом блока памяти, а выход является информационным выходом устройства. На чертеже представлена структурная схема устройства. Устройство для ввода информации содержит клавиатуру 1, шифратор 2, блок памяти 3, первый одновибратор 4, первый элемент ИЛИ 5, генератор 6 распределитель импульсов .7, формирователь контрольного разряда 8, второй ИЛИ 9, третий элемент ИЛИ 10, триггер 11, второй одновибратор 12, счетчик адреса 13, блок усилителей 14, управлякядий выход 15 информационный выход 16. Устройство работает следующим об разом, Устройство приводится в 11сходное состояние наж4тием на клавиатуре 1 кнопки Сброс. При этом на треть ем выходе клавиатуры появляется высокий уровень сигнала, поступающий на первый вход установки в нуль сче чика адреса 13 и на третий вход второго элемента ИЛИ 9, с выхода которого поступает сигнал на вход первого оДновибратора 4, вызывая его ерабатывание. На выходе одновибратора 4 формируется импульс, который поступает через элемент ИЛИ 10 иа счетный вхор счетчика адреса 13, состояние кофрого при этом не меняется из-за присутствия сигнала установки в нуль на его пербом вхсяе. Одновременно с этим импульс с выхода одновибратора 4 поступает на вход записи блока памяти 3 и через элемент ИЛИ 5 на вход выборки блока памяти 3, производя за пись нулей, присутствующих на информационных первом, четвертом и пятом входах блока по нулевому адресу, фор NuipyeMoMy счетчиком адреса 13. Кроме того, импульс с выхода одновибратора 4 поступает на тактовый вход триггера 11, записывая в него спадом импульса логический нуль, поступающий с второго выхода клавиатуры 1 на первый вход триггера 11, При этом на вход генератора 6 подается сигнал, блокирующий его работу. На управляющем выходе устройства 15 присутствует низкий уровень сигнала, а информационный выход 16 находится в состоянии высокого импеданса, В режиме набора данных при нгикатии кнопки на клавиатуре 1, соответствующей вводимому числу, на выходе шифратора 2 формируется п-разрядный код, которлй поступает на первый вход элемента ИЛИ 9, на первый вход блока памяти 3 и на вход формирователя контрольного разряда 8, с выхода которого (п+1)-ый разряд кода подается на четвертый вход блока памяти 3. При этом на втором выходе клавиатуры 1 присутствует низкий уровень сигнала. На выходе элемента ИЛИ 9 появляется сигнал, поступающий на вход одновибратора 4, на выходе которого формируется импульс, который через элемент ИЛИ 10 поступает на счетный вход счетчика адреса 13, увеличивая его содержимое на единицу. При этом импульс с выхода одновибратора 4 поступает также на вход записи блока памяти 3 и через элемент ИЛИ 5 на вход выборки блока пакшти 3. В блок памяти 3 по новому адресу происходит запись п-разрядного кода по первому входу с выхода шифратора 2, (п-И)-огб разряда кода по четвертому входу с выхода формирователя коитрольного разряда 8 и (п+2)-ого.разряда по пятому входу со второго выхода клавиатуры 1, так как длительность импульса на выходе записи и входе выборки блока памяти 3 значительно больше времени установки счетчика адреса 13. Триггер 11 в этом случае своего состояния не меняет. При наборе следующего числа на клавиатуре 1 аналогичным образом происходит запись нового (п+2)-разряд- него кода в блок памяти 3 по адресу, увеличенному на единицу. Максимальный объем заносимых таким образом в блок П 1мяти 3 данных определяется разрящностью его адресных вхсщов. Максимальное количество циклов К ввода данных в блок памяти определяется по формуле: К 2 - 2, где Р - разрядность адресных входов блока памяти. В формуле учтено, что первая и последняя ячейки блока памяти используются для фиксации начала и конца массива вводимых данных. Данные выводятся из блока памяти при нажатии кнопки Пуск на клавиатуре 1. При этом на втором выходу клавиатуры появляется высокий уровен сигнала, который поступает на первый вход триггера 11, на пятый вход блОка памяти 3 и через элемент ИЛИ 9 на вход оцновибратора 4, на выходе которого формируется импульс, который по адресу, увеличенному на единицу, производит запись (п+2)-разрядного кода в блок памяти 3, причем по первому и четвертому входам записываются логические нули, а по пятому входу логическая единица. Спадом импуль са с выхода одновибратора 4 в триггер 11 записывается логическая едяница, которая присутствует на его первом входе. Одновременно с этим положительным перепадом сигнала с выхода триггера 11 запускается одновибратор 12, который формирует короткий импульс, поступающий на второй вход установки в нуль счетчика адреса 13, обнуляя его содержание. Высокий уровень сигнала на выходе триггера 11 снимает блокировку генератора 6, который запускает распределитель импульсов 7. Импульсй с пер вого выхода распределителя импульсов 7 через элемент ИЛИ 10 поступают на счетный вход счетчика адреса 13, уве личивая его содержимое на единицу. Импульсы со второго выхода распределителя импульсов 7 через элемент ИЛИ 5 поступают на вход выборки бяока памяти 3, на управляющий выход 15 устройства, на первый вход блока уси лителей 14, на выходе 16 которого появляется (п+1)-разрядный код, считанный из блока памяти 3 по nepBOW адресу. Последовательный вывод кода из блока памяти 3 производится автоматически до тех пор, пока на втором выходе блока памяти 3 не появится си нал логической единицы, записгшйый по последнему адресу в блок памяти 3 в режиме набора данных по пятому вхо ду, со второго выхода клавиатуры 1 который поступает на вход установки в нуль триггера 11. При этом на илходе триггера 11 устанавливается низ кий уровень сигнала, блокирующий работу генератора 6. При необходимости вывод,кода из блока памяти 3 можно повторить иажатием кнопки Пуск на клавиатуре 1 Таким образом, устройство позволяет производить ввод массива дайных .произвольной длины и передачу их по длинным линиям связи, расширяя этим свалил область применения устройства. , Формула изобретения Устройство для ввода информации, содержащее клавиатуру, первый выход которой подключен через шифратор к первому входу блока памяти, первый одновибратор, подключенный к второму входу блока памяти, первый элемент ИЛИ, подключенный к третьему входу блока памяти, и генератор, подключенный к входу распределителя импульсов, отличающеес я тем, что, с целью расширения области применения устройства путем ввода массива данных произвольной длины, в него вве-. дены формирователь контрольного рагзряда, первый и второй элементы ИЛИ, триггер, второй одновибраТор, счетчик адреса и блок,усилителей, причем вход формирователя контрольного разряда соединен с выходом шифратора и первым входом второго элемента ИЛИ, а.выход - с четвертым входом блока Пс1мяти, пятый вход которогЬ соединен с вторым выходом клавиатуры, первым входом триггера и вторым входом второго элемента ИЛИ, третий вход котоf oro соединен с третьим выходом клавиатуры и первым входсм счетчика адреса, а выход второго элемента ИЛИ подключен к входу первого одновибратора, выход которого соединен с первыми входами первого и третьего элемента ИЛИ и вторым входом триггера, третий вход которого соединен с вторым выходом блока памяти, а выход триггера - с входами генератора и второго одновибратора, выход которого соединен с вторым входом счетчика адреса, выход которого пспключен к шестому входу блока памяти, а третий вход счетчика адреса соединен с шдхОдом третьего элемента ИЛИ, второй вход которого соединен ,с первым выходом распределителя импульсов, второй выход которого является управляющим выходом устройства и подключен к второму входу первого элемента ИЛИ и к первому входу блока усилителей, второй вход которого соединен с первым выходом блока памяти, а выход является информационным выхоцом устройства. Источники информации, псяинятые во внимание при экспертизе 1.Авторское свидетельство СССР 549798, кл. G 06 F 3/02, 1977. 2.Авторское свидетельство СССР №641432, КП. G Об F 3/02, 1979 (прототип).I

SU 959 058 A1

Авторы

Емец Сергей Иванович

Куликов Петр Петрович

Кийко Николай Иванович

Петренко Игорь Давыдович

Даты

1982-09-15Публикация

1980-12-29Подача